Cambrian comb jellies from Utah illuminate the early evolution of nervous and sensory systems in ctenophores
Summary: Ctenophores are a group of predatory macroinvertebrates whose controversial phylogenetic position has prompted several competing hypotheses regarding the evolution of animal organ systems.
